Back to Top

Multi Wishlists for Shopware 6

Updated 6 October 2023


The Multi Wishlists for Shopware 6 module provides an easy way for consumers to create separate wishlists. Consumers can create as many wishlists of their popular products. The Shopware store only allows registered consumers to add their favorite products.

With the help of this module, the admin can view all the wishlists for each consumer from the Shopware backend. The customer can delete and update the wishlist.

Check a brief overview of the plugin –



  • The admin can set the number of wishlists a customer can create.
  • The admin can also set the number of products that a customer can add to a wishlist.
  • A customer can create as many wishlists of their favorite products.
  • A customer can add a product from the category as well as a product page.
  • Add the products from the wishlist to the cart.
  • The customers can share the wishlists with their friends or family members through email.
  • Remove the products from the wishlist as per requirement.
  • A consumer can delete and update a wishlist.


Shopware provides two ways to install the plugin to the server.

  1. Using Command
  2. Manual installation

Installation Using Commands

Consumers will get a zip folder, then they have to extract the contents of this zip folder on their system. The consumer has Copy the folder WebkulMwl to custom/plugins directory of Shopware6. As shown in the below image:

Searching for an experienced
Shopware Company ?
Find out More

Now open the Shopware6 application in the Terminal.

Run this command to refresh the plugin –

/bin/console plugin:refresh

Go to your Shopware installation Root directory and run this command to install then activate the plugin –

./bin/console plugin:install --activate

To clear the cache run this command –

./bin/console c:c

Now refresh the administration.

Manual Installation

For the manual installation of the plugin follow the steps as mentioned below:

1) Extract the zip file of the plugin.

2) Goto your Shopware 6 installation backend panel and navigate to  Extensions-> My Extensions after that you can find all the installed plugins in it.

For installing the plugin, the user can click on the Upload Extension button. The user can upload the plugin zip(WebkulMwl) here.

3) After uploading the plugin zip, the user can see the Extensions in the list.

4) Now the user can click on the install icon to install the Multi Wish List extension.

5) After the installation of the extension, the user can click to activate the extension.

While in the process the admin can see the success message ‘Extension has been activated‘.

After the installation process and plugin configuration if the Multi Wish List  icon option is not visible then run this command to clear the cache:

1php bin/console cache:clear


After the successful installation of the Multi Wishlists for Shopware 6 module, The user can click on the “…” icon for the configuration.

When you will click on the Config button a new page will open. Here you have to fill in the options.

Sales channel – Select the sales channel.

Total number of allowed wishlist – Enter the total number of allowed wishlist

Total allowed items per wishlist – Enter Total allowed items per wishlist

Share wishlist – Enable/disable the option to share the wishlist.

Show wishlist Button on Shopping cart – Enable/disable the option to add button in shopping cart

Enter the subject for admin – In this add the mail subject.

Enter the content for admin – Add-in which content mail will be sent.

After that click on the Save button.

Shopware backend

Go to Settings>Extensions> Customers Wishlist. Here you will see the customer’s name.

After that click on Customer Wishlist.

When you will click on the view button a new page “User wishlist” opens. Here you will see the wishlist names.

For User Wishlist Products, you can click on the view button.

Shopware Front-end

Now go to the Shopware store. First of all the customer has to log in to create a wishlist. To create a new wishlist, a customer has to click on the Multi Wish List option on my account.


Creating Multiple Wishlists

Now the customer has to click on Create New to for creating a new wishlist.


The customer has to enter Wishlist Name then need to select the status private or public after that click on Add Wishlist button.


After creating a wishlist a customer has to add his/her favorite products to that particular wishlist. A customer can add a product to the wishlist from a category page as well as from the search page.


When the customer clicks on a wishlist button, a block will appear on a web page in which he/she has to select the Multi wish list and then click on Add To Wishlist.


Note: Product which has been added to a wishlist once, then it cannot be added to the wishlist again.

On product page you can add the product to product list as shown in below image.


On shopping cart page you can add the product to product list as shown in below image.


After that on checkout page you can add the product to product list as shown in below image.


Manage Wishlists

Once the wishlists have been created, the customer can update and delete the wishlists.


After clicking on Manage Wishlist a customer can update a wishlist name and delete a wishlist according to his/her requirement.


A Customer can check the configuration that has been set by the admin for his wishlist manager. To check that configration click on allowed wishlist setting.


A customer can delete the products from a wishlist. Customers can also add the product to the cart from the wishlist.


You can copy or move the product from one wish list to another.


Wishlists Sharing

A customer can share the wishlists with his/her friends and family members through email.


After clicking on the Share Wishlists option, the customer has to enter the emails of people with whom he wants to share the wishlist.


A customer has to enter the message which will be received by the people of whom he has entered email ids. A customer can also remove the email id. After entering a message and email ids, a customer has to click on the share button so that the wishlist email can be received by the people of whom email ids have been entered.


After that customer will receive the mail.


When you will click on the link it will redirect to share wish list.


Need Help?

That is all about the Multi Wishlists for Shopware 6 module, for any issues feel free to add a ticket and let us know your views to make the module better

Please explore our shopware development services and Quality shopware extensions .

Current Product Version - 1.0.4.

Supported Framework Version - Shopware

Blog Version - Shopware
  • Version Shopware
  • Version Shopware
  • Version Shopware 6.1.1 stable version
. . .

Leave a Comment

Your email address will not be published. Required fields are marked*

Be the first to comment.

Back to Top

Message Sent!

If you have more details or questions, you can reply to the received confirmation email.

Back to Home

Table of Content